William Hunter's house, and the Windmill Street School of Medicine: seen from the south, c1880s. Additional Info: William Hunter's house, anatomical theatre, and museum were built for him in Great Windmill Street, Soho, in 1767 by Robert Mylne. The specimens from the museum were left by Hunter to Glasgow University on his death. The house later became a restaurant and, in 1887, was incorporated into the Lyric Theatre as dressing rooms. It survives in this form, with a "Blue Plaque" to Hunter, today (1997).
